These slippers by Phipps's offer a glimpse into the intimate lives of the past, whispering stories of gender, class, and identity. Imagine the world in which these slippers were worn - a world of rigid social structures, where clothing was a powerful signifier of status and gender. These delicate, silken slippers speak to the leisure and privilege afforded to certain women. What did it mean to be a woman who could afford such delicate footwear, impractical for any labor beyond the domestic sphere? The soft material and simple design contrast with the restrictive corsets and elaborate gowns of the time, suggesting a moment of quiet reprieve. Consider the weight of societal expectations these women carried, and the silent language of their clothing. These slippers, in their quiet elegance, invite us to reflect on the complexities of women's lives throughout history, their confined spaces, and the subtle ways they navigated their identities within a patriarchal world.
